Lillian A. Bobak, age 85 of Rossford, Ohio passed away on Saturday, July 14, 2012 at Hospice of Northwest Ohio. She was born on July 26, 1926 in Toledo to Frank and Bertha (Kozicki) Kamza. Lillian was employed with Libbey Owen Ford Glass Company for many years. She was a parishioner of All Saints Catholic Church and a former member of St. Michael’s Ukrainian Church and the former Ukrainian Club. She was also involved in The Rossford Eagles, Glassworkers Local 9, The Democratic Party and enjoyed traveling and taking casino trips. Lillian was very generous to her family. Many times she gave help before you even knew you needed it. She was a very dear sister and aunt and will be deeply missed. She is survived by her sisters, Rosemarie Janowiecki and Bernice Felt along with many nieces and nephews. Also surviving are many dear friends. She was preceded in death by her husband Daniel Bobak in 1996; her parents; and her siblings, Stella Kamza, Lucille Staczek, Virgil Kamza, Chester Kamcza, Harry Kamza, Richard “Pete” Kamcza, Gerald Kamcza, Joyce Hart and Irene Herron.
